A longitudinal study on the acceptance and effects of a therapeutic renal food in pet dogs with IRIS-Stage 1 chronic kidney disease

Abstract

Currently, nutritional management is recommended when serum creatinine (Cr) exceeds 1.4 mg/dl in dogs with IRIS-Stage 2 chronic kidney disease (CKD) to slow progressive loss of kidney function, reduce clinical and biochemical consequences of CKD, and maintain adequate nutrition. It is unknown if dietary interventions benefit non-azotemic dogs at earlier stages. A prospective 12-month feeding trial was performed in client-owned dogs with IRIS-Stage 1 CKD (n = 36; 20 had persistently dilute urine with urine specific gravity (USG) <1.020 without identifiable non-renal cause; six had persistent proteinuria of renal origin with urine protein creatinine (UPC) ratio >0.5; 10 had both). Ease of transition to therapeutic renal food and effects on renal biomarkers and quality of life attributes were assessed. Dogs were transitioned over 1 week from grocery-branded foods to renal food. At 0, 3, 6, 9, and 12-months a questionnaire to assess owner's perception of their pet's acceptance of renal food and quality of life was completed. Renal biomarkers, including serum Cr, blood urea nitrogen (BUN), and symmetric dimethylarginine (SDMA), and USG and UPC ratio were measured. Of 36 dogs initially enrolled, 35 (97%) dogs were transitioned to therapeutic renal food. Dogs moderately or extremely liked the food 88% of the time, ate most or all of the food 84% of the time, and were moderately or extremely enthusiastic while eating 76% of the time. All renal biomarkers (Cr, BUN, and SDMA) were decreased (p ≤.05) from baseline at 3-months, and remained decreased from baseline at 12-months in dogs completing the study (n = 20).
